USA: Villaraigosa announces electric car infrastructure plan

Los Angeles is known by many names, among them “the quintessential city of sprawl,” “the congestion capital of the world” and the consistently top-ranked area with the country’s worst air pollution.

Mayor Antonio Villaraigosa has said it all himself, yet he still seems to believe that the city can serve another, simultaneous function: as the eco-friendly launchpad for electric cars.

By the time the vehicles are expected to appear in significant numbers in the market – late 2010 to early 2011 – Los Angeles and a coalition of partners are expected to have at least a skeleton infrastructure of charging stations ready to go, he said.
